Webb21 okt. 2024 · – Today, the Department of Justice announced a global resolution of its criminal and civil investigations into the opioid manufacturer Purdue Pharma LP (Purdue) and a civil resolution of its civil investigation into individual shareholders from the Sackler family. The resolutions with Purdue are subject to the approval of the bankruptcy court. WebbRaymond Sackler, Purdue Pharma's other former chief executive, died in 2024 at age 97.
